(And Why It Matters Now)Business automation enterprise guide 2026Business automation is the use of technology to execute business processes with minimal human intervention — from simple tasks (auto-sending an email) to complex decisions (approving a loan based on multiple variables, regulatory checks, and risk scoring). The numbers explain the urgency:MetricValueSourceEnterprises automating >50% by 202630% (up from 10% in 2023)Gartner / WorkdayGlobal automation market (2025)$226.8BThunderbitMarket projection$600B+ThunderbitExecutives planning AI automation92%IBM IBVLeaders citing GenAI for automation87%IBM IBVIBM internal: AI assistants/agents2,000+ (85,000 users)IBMIBM productivity increase+50%IBMFortune 500 with Copilot70%MicrosoftEnterprise apps with AI agents (2026)40% (up from 5% in 2025)ThunderbitThe 6 Levels of Business AutomationExtending Blue Prism's evolution model (RPA → intelligent automation → hyperautomation → agentic AI) with the layer no competitor covers:LevelTypeWhat It DoesExampleTools1Workflow automationConnects apps, triggers rulesNew lead → Slack notification + CRM entryZapier, Make, n8n2RPAReplicates human actions in UICopy data from ERP to spreadsheetUiPath, Blue Prism, AA3BPA (Business Process)Automates end-to-end processesInvoice approval from receipt to paymentPower Automate, ServiceNow4Intelligent automationAI makes decisions on dataChatbot resolving complex queries with RAGChatGPT + RAG, Claude5HyperautomationRPA + AI + process miningDetect bottleneck → redesign → automateCelonis, IBM Cloud Pak6Smart contract automationCode executes on blockchain when conditions are metAutomatic payment on delivery confirmationSolidity, ERC-3643Most businesses are between levels 1-2. The biggest ROI jump happens at level 2→3 — moving from isolated task automation to end-to-end process automation.Business Automation Tools Compared (2026)Workflow & SMB ToolsToolTypePriceBest ForComplexityZapierWorkflowFrom $19.99/moSMBs, simple app connectionsLowMakeVisual workflowFrom $9/moSMBs, complex visual logicLow-mediumn8nWorkflow (open source)Free (self-hosted)Technical teams, full controlMediumPower AutomateBPA$15/user/moMicrosoft 365 enterprisesMediumEnterprise RPA PlatformsPlatformDifferentiatorBest ForPricingUiPathLargest RPA marketplace, AI integrationEnterprise, legacy systemsCustomBlue PrismBest evolution model (RPA→hyperautomation)Regulated industriesCustomAutomation AnywhereCloud-native, AI-firstMid-market to enterpriseCustomIBM Cloud PakFull hyperautomation suiteLarge corporationsCustomHow to choose: SMB with basic needs → Zapier or Make. Microsoft shop → Power Automate. Complex legacy processes → UiPath. Regulated industry → Blue Prism. Full hyperautomation → IBM Cloud Pak.Identifying What to Automate: Prioritization FrameworkNot every process should be automated. Web3 development.How to Calculate Automation ROIFormulaCalculationExampleDirect ROI(Annual savings - Implementation cost) / Cost × 100$60K savings, $20K cost → 200% ROIEfficiency gain(Hours before - Hours after) / Hours before × 10040h → 10h/week → 75% improvementCost per transactionTotal cost / Number of transactions$0.10 automated vs $5 manualPayback periodImplementation cost / Monthly savings$20K / $5K = 4 monthsBenchmarks: RPA delivers 200%+ ROI. 57% of companies see significant ROI within 12 months. IBM reports +50% productivity across 85,000 users with 2,000+ AI assistants.Implementing Business Automation: 7-Step FrameworkMap processes (week 1-2): Document current workflows, identify bottlenecks and repetitive tasksPrioritize (week 2): Use the impact/effort matrix — start with high-impact, low-effortChoose automation level (week 3): Workflow? RPA? AI? Use the 6-level maturity modelSelect tools (week 3-4): Evaluate 2-3 options based on ecosystem and budgetPilot (week 4-8): Automate 1-2 processes with a small team, measure resultsMeasure ROI (week 8-10): Compare before vs after metrics, calculate with formulas aboveScale (week 10+): Progressive rollout 20% → 50% → 100%, department-specific trainingEU AI Act and Automated Decision-MakingThe EU AI Act (August 2, 2026 deadline) directly impacts business automation when AI makes decisions:High-risk automated decisions: Credit scoring, hiring, medical diagnosis — require documentation, human oversight, transparencyPenalties: Up to €35M or 7% of global revenue (Javadex)Requirements: Technical documentation, risk management, data quality, human-in-the-loop for high-riskFor most automation (marketing, operations, reporting): Low regulatory risk, but transparency requiredThe Future: Net +78 Million Jobs by 2030Automation doesn't destroy jobs — it transforms them. According to Thunderbit, automation will displace 92 million jobs but create 170 million by 2030 — a net gain of +78 million positions globally. What's coming 2026-2030:Agentic AI everywhere: From chatbots to autonomous agents that plan and executeHyperautomation convergence: RPA + AI + process mining + blockchainSmart contracts + AI: Intelligent automation on blockchain — AI decisions that trigger automated contractsDemocratized automation: No-code/low-code tools enabling any employee to automateFrequently Asked Questions About Business AutomationWhat is business automation?Business automation is the use of technology to execute business processes with minimal human intervention. It spans six levels: workflow automation (Zapier, Make), RPA (UiPath), business process automation, intelligent automation (AI), hyperautomation, and smart contract automation (blockchain). The market reached $226.8B in 2025 with 30% of enterprises automating over half their activities by 2026.What's the ROI of business automation?RPA delivers 200%+ ROI as a benchmark. 57% of companies see significant ROI within 12 months. IBM reports +50% productivity with 85,000 users and 2,000+ AI assistants. Payback periods for basic automation: 3-6 months. Cost per automated transaction: $0.10 vs $5+ manual.Which processes should I automate first?High-volume, rule-based, repetitive, error-prone processes. Finance (bank reconciliation, invoicing), marketing (email sequences, reporting), and HR (CV screening, onboarding) are the best starting points. 80% of financial transactional work can be automated with RPA + AI.Zapier, Make, or Power Automate?Zapier for simple app connections (SMBs). Make for complex visual workflows (SMBs). Power Automate if you're a Microsoft 365 shop. n8n if you want open-source self-hosted. For enterprise RPA: UiPath, Blue Prism, or Automation Anywhere. For hyperautomation: IBM Cloud Pak.What are smart contracts as automation?Smart contracts are code on blockchain that executes automatically when conditions are met — no intermediaries, no errors. Business applications: automatic payments on delivery, compliance verification (ERC-3643), governance voting, escrow.
